Re: pic: 2412 Electronics! Top Level

Nice Power Distribution Board setup. However, I don't think this is legal. Seems like in the current configuration you're violating <R39>.

<R39> The PD Board and all circuit breakers must be easily visible for Inspection.

Having the upper shelf on top of the PD Board seems like it would violate this, no?

Re: pic: 2412 Electronics! Top Level

Yes, the upper board hinges out of the way very easily, and allows full access to the all of the breakers and wago connectors. Our students also labeled all of the speed controllers and breakers.
All 12V supply is run on the lower layer, and all signal/control is run on the upper layer.
The whole board is modular and can be removed from the robot in less than a minute.

Best board our team has ever done by far.
